Output ed941831a18f224ac304df66fe80596b7d53a45abf5f3c8fa854872eb847f6e2:52

value
17833
script pubkey
OP_0 OP_PUSHBYTES_20 0840235b61213fa9ac7e0d6bc7c8e2ffac701e9f
address
bc1qppqzxkmpyyl6ntr7p44u0j8zl7k8q85l4gur2e
transaction
ed941831a18f224ac304df66fe80596b7d53a45abf5f3c8fa854872eb847f6e2
confirmations
64653
spent
true